How to Book a VFS Poland Visa Appointment in India: A Complete 2026 Step-by-Step Guide

By traveldham
August 4, 2026 9 Min Read
0

Securing entry to Poland is highly sought-after by Indian professionals, students, and travelers. However, the process begins with obtaining a VFS Poland visa appointment, which often frustrates unprepared/ unprepared applicants due to high demand. Success in this initial phase is not about luck. It demands a precise understanding of the system and absolute accuracy in documentation. For Indian applicants looking to submit their files in 2026, the key is to understand how the system functions and secure a slot without unnecessary delays.

Key Takeaways

  • Jurisdiction Matters: You must book your appointment at the VFS center matching your official state of residence.
  • Exact Visa Match: Booking a Schengen (Type C) slot for a National (Type D) visa application will lead to immediate rejection at the counter.
  • High Demand Slots: Appointment slots are released in batches with no warning and can disappear within 90 seconds.
  • Non-Refundable Fees: Both VFS service fees and consular visa fees are strictly non-refundable, regardless of the visa decision.
  • Preparation is Key: Arriving 15 minutes early with fully compliant travel insurance and a well-structured cover letter is vital for success.

Understanding Poland Visa Categories for Indian Applicants

Schengen Visa (Type C) vs. National Visa (Type D)

Before booking, applicants must identify the purpose of their stay. Selecting the incorrect category will result in immediate rejection, forcing applicants to repeat the entire process.

The primary distinction lies between the Schengen Visa (Type C) and National Visa (Type D). The Type C visa is for stays up to 90 days. For these short-term stays, securing a poland schengen visa appointment is the required path. Conversely, the Type D visa is designed for stays exceeding 90 days, required for employment or study. For long-term stays, securing a poland national visa appointment is the first critical milestone.

The comparison below highlights the fundamental differences between these two visa classes:

Visa FeatureSchengen Visa (Type C)National Visa (Type D)
Maximum Duration90 days within a 180-day window91 to 365 days
Primary PurposeTourism, business meetings, family visitsEmployment, university study, research
Appointment TypeRequires a poland schengen visa appointmentRequires a poland national visa appointment
Key RequirementDetailed tourism itinerary and hotel bookingsWork permit or university admission letter

Booking a VFS Poland visa appointment requires selecting the exact visa type. If an applicant registers for a Type C slot but presents a Type D application, staff will refuse submission. Consular reports (as far as current data suggests) show that mismatched classes are a major cause of rejection. Step-by-Step Guide to Booking Your VFS Poland Visa Appointment

Step 1: Determine Your Visa Category and Jurisdiction

Consular jurisdiction is strictly enforced in India, split as follows:

  • New Delhi Embassy: Northern and eastern states of India.
  • Mumbai Consulate: Western and southern states of India.

Booking a VFS Poland visa appointment outside your jurisdiction leads to rejection, unless you provide a registered rental agreement as proof of relocation.

The official portal manages all poland visa appointment booking requests in India. Confirm your VFS center aligns with your residency. For example, Karnataka residents must book under the Mumbai jurisdiction (such as Bengaluru).

Step 2: Complete the Visa Application Form

You must complete the visa application form before booking. For National Visa (Type D) applications, this is done via the e-Konsulat platform. Print, sign, and ensure the barcode is legible.

For Schengen Visa (Type C) applications, fill out the form on the VFS portal. This form, with its unique registration number, is required before booking a VFS Poland visa appointment through the portal.

Step 3: Create an Account on the VFS Global Portal

Access the VFS Global platform for Poland and create a unique user account. This account is mandatory for setting up a VFS Poland visa appointment slot. The platform utilizes strict security measures to prevent bots, so expect complex CAPTCHAs.

Step 4: Select Your Center and Secure the Slot

Log in and select your preferred center. Due to high demand, a successful poland visa appointment booking requires daily monitoring. Slots are released in batches with very little warning.

Securing a VFS Poland visa appointment requires patience. When a slot becomes available, select your date immediately. Consular reports show slots disappear within 90 seconds. Knowing when the VFS Poland visa appointment system resets (often around midnight) gives you an advantage. This rapid depletion makes finding a VFS Poland visa appointment online a major obstacle.

Step 5: Pay the VFS Service Fee Online

The final step is paying the service fee online via card or UPI. Once confirmed, the system generates an Appointment Confirmation Letter containing your reference number. This confirmation completes the initial VFS Poland visa appointment registration. Print and keep this copy, as you cannot enter the center without it.

Mandatory Documents Checklist for Poland Visa Applicants

Core Financial and Professional Documents

Presenting an organized dossier when attending your VFS Poland visa appointment in person determines whether your visa will be granted. The Polish consulate is known for its rigorous verification process.

Your application must be accompanied by a well-structured cover letter explaining why the VFS Poland visa appointment was scheduled under your selected category, detailing your itinerary, and confirming your return plans.

The core of your dossier must include proof of sufficient financial sustenance. This must be backed by original, stamped bank statements for the past three to six months. In addition, professional documents are required and must be produced during the VFS Poland visa appointment itself. This includes an official NOC (No Objection Certificate) and recent salary slips, or business registration documents if self-employed.

Accommodation and Travel Itinerary Proofs

To satisfy the accommodation and travel requirements, you must provide:

  • Confirmed hotel bookings, a registered rental agreement, or an official invitation letter registered with the Voivodeship office in Poland.
  • Flight bookings demonstrating a confirmed round-trip itinerary.
  • Schengen-compliant travel insurance policy.

Travel insurance is also mandatory. It must have a minimum coverage of 30,000 Euros and be valid across all Schengen countries. Presenting this is mandatory at your VFS Poland visa appointment as proof of medical emergency coverage. The table below outlines the essential documentation checklist:

Document CategoryRequired ItemsConsular Purpose
Identity ProofsOriginal passport (valid for 3+ months), 2 biometric photosVerification of identity and travel history
Financial Proofs3-6 months bank statements (stamped), ITR certificatesDemonstration of financial self-sufficiency
Travel DetailsRound-trip flights, hotel confirmations, detailed cover letterVerification of travel intent and return plans
Medical CoverageSchengen-compliant travel insurance (minimum €30,000)Emergency medical and repatriation coverage

Processing Time, Visa Fees, and Tracking Your Status

Fee Breakdown and Payment Guidelines

Understanding timelines and financial requirements is crucial to avoiding last-minute stress. Once you have attended your VFS Poland visa appointment, the typical processing time for a Schengen visa is 15 calendar days, extending up to 45 days. For national visas, processing usually takes between 15 to 30 days, depending on the consulate’s workload.

The fees are structured into two main components: the consular fee and the VFS service charge. The consular fee for both Schengen and National visas is approximately 90 Euros (payable in Indian Rupees based on current exchange rates). The VFS service fee is roughly 10 to 15 Euros. These fees are non-refundable.

Visa ParameterSchengen Visa (Type C) DetailsNational Visa (Type D) Details
Standard Processing Time15 calendar days (can extend up to 45 days)15 to 30 days (depending on consular workload)
Consular Visa Fee~90 Euros (payable in INR equivalent)~90 Euros (payable in INR equivalent)
VFS Service Fee~10 to 15 Euros (payable in INR)~10 to 15 Euros (payable in INR)
Fee Refundability StatusStrictly Non-refundableStrictly Non-refundable

VFS Poland Visa Tracking Process

Following the completion of the VFS Poland visa appointment, applicants must track their status. VFS provides an online portal for status verification, which requires your reference number and date of birth.

Applicants can utilize the vfs poland visa tracking system on the website to monitor the progress of their passport. Once the decision is made, the vfs poland visa tracking utility will indicate that the envelope is ready for collection or has been dispatched via courier. This status update is highly important, especially for those with travel dates approaching quickly.

Let’s look at the standard steps involved in tracking your application status:

  • Check the reference number on your VFS invoice receipt.
  • Visit the official VFS tracking portal for Poland.
  • Enter your reference number and last name precisely.
  • Review the current status (e.g., ‘Under Process at Consulate’ or ‘Ready for Collection’).
  • Opt for SMS alerts during booking to receive instant updates directly on your mobile device.

Overcoming Common Challenges in Securing an Appointment Slot

Securing a VFS Poland visa appointment is often the most challenging part of the process, primarily due to the severe imbalance between supply and demand. Many applicants face constant ‘No slots available’ messages. This situation is particularly acute during peak student intake periods (usually July to September) and the summer holiday travel season.

To overcome these challenges, many experienced applicants recommend checking the portal during off-peak hours, such as early morning or late at night. Consular updates suggest that system updates and slot cancellations are often processed during these times, making it easier to book a VFS Poland visa appointment without competing against thousands of other users simultaneously. But still, diligent monitoring of the portal usually yields results for those who persevere.

Additionally, ensuring your personal data is saved and easily accessible is a critical strategy. The VFS system is notorious for logging users out after a brief period of inactivity. Having your passport number and details ready in a separate document allows you to copy and paste them rapidly, securing the slot before the system times out. If you encounter recurring errors, clearing your browser cache can resolve minor technical glitches.

Preparing for Your VFS Poland Visa Appointment Day

Preparing for Your VFS Poland Visa Appointment Day

The day of your interview requires meticulous preparation. Before arriving at the VFS Poland visa appointment center, double-check that you have all documents sorted according to the official checklist. It is highly recommended to arrive at least 15 minutes before your scheduled slot. Late arrivals are generally not accommodated, and missing your time will require you to start the scheduling process again.

Upon arrival, you will go through a security screening. Electronic items, including mobile phones and laptops, are strictly prohibited inside the submission area. You must arrange to store these items outside the center or use the locker facilities provided at some VFS locations for an additional fee.

During the physical VFS Poland visa appointment, an officer will review your documents, scan your biometrics (fingerprints and facial photograph), and may ask brief questions regarding your travel plans. It is important to answer these questions calmly and professionally, ensuring your verbal answers match the details provided in your written application. Once the process is complete, you will receive an acknowledgment receipt which must be kept safe for passport collection.

Frequently Asked Questions

How far in advance should I book my VFS Poland visa appointment?

It is highly advisable to book your slot at least 45 to 60 days before your intended travel date. This timeline accounts for potential delays in slot availability, processing times at the consulate, and any unforeseen administrative requirements. Applicants must remember that a poland schengen visa appointment cannot be booked more than six months in advance, but leaving it to the last minute is a risky strategy that can disrupt your entire itinerary. For students, starting this process in May for a September intake is arguably the most sensible approach.

Can I reschedule my VFS Poland visa appointment online?

Yes, the VFS portal allows applicants to reschedule their appointments online, but this is subject to strict limitations. Generally, you can only reschedule your booking up to two times, and the changes must be made at least 48 hours prior to your original appointment date. If you fail to reschedule within this window or exhaust your attempts, you will have to cancel the appointment, forfeit your service fee, and pay a new fee to schedule a fresh VFS Poland visa appointment. Therefore, always confirm your availability before finalizing the booking details to avoid paying unnecessary charges.

What happens if I miss my scheduled VFS Poland visa appointment?

If you miss your scheduled appointment, you will be marked as a no-show in the VFS system. In most cases, you will not be allowed to book another slot using the same profile for 24 to 48 hours. Furthermore, the VFS service fee paid online is completely non-refundable. To secure a new date, you will have to wait for the system lockout period to expire and pay the service fee again to book a new slot. This lockout period is strictly enforced to deter bad actors from hoarding appointment slots.

Is the VFS service fee refundable if my visa is rejected?

No, the VFS service fee, along with the consular visa fee, is completely non-refundable. These fees are charged for the administrative processing of your application and passport handling, not for the outcome of the visa decision itself. Even if your application is denied or if you choose to withdraw your application mid-process, the fees will not be returned. This is why ensuring complete compliance and document accuracy before submission is highly critical. Double-checking every document reduces the chance of losing both time and money.
